Program Components

  • Three Full Day In-Person Sessions

    Held every three months, these in-person sessions provide immersive, reflective experiences where participants will connect deeply within cohorts and engage in facilitated learning.

  • Monthly Online Cohort Sessions

    A 60-minute virtual session each month offers space to share insights, practice new tools, and build community across the cohort.

  • Digital Learning Journal

    The online journal is a personalized leadership logbook, used in order to:

    > Capture assessments

    > Develop and track personal growth goals

    > Reflect on personal experiences

  • Daily Workweek Prompts

    Quick, 5-minute prompts delivered Monday–Friday support:

    > Ongoing self-reflection

    > Skill application

    > Consistent alignment with stated goals

    These can completed daily or in one 30-minute weekly session—whatever works best for each participant.

Modern Leadership Competencies

  • Effective leadership begins with self-awareness. Understanding your motivations, responses to pressure, strengths, and blind spots is essential for leading authentically and recognizing your impact on others. Understand your unique leadership style and how it influences your impact. This self-awareness helps align actions with values and build trust with those you lead.

  • Leaders face tests during stressful moments. The ability to thoughtfully regulate emotions, rather than suppress them, distinguishes great leaders. Emotional regulation allows leaders to stay composed, make clear decisions, and inspire confidence in their teams.

  • Communication is essential for effective leadership. It involves not only speaking persuasively but also listening deeply and ensuring everyone feels valued. Strong communication skills help leaders build relationships, align teams, and resolve misunderstandings before they escalate.

    Conflict is natural in groups, but effective leaders view it as an opportunity. By approaching conflict with curiosity and empathy, they turn tension into progress. Skilled leaders in conflict resolution promote healthier team dynamics and leverage differing perspectives for better outcomes.

  • Strengthen focus, judgment, and strategic thinking. Leadership involves managing oneself as much as others. Effective leaders prioritize and use their time wisely, creating clarity for their teams. By modeling discipline and respecting others' time, they foster a productive and balanced workplace.
